Bromination of 1,1-diarylethylenes with bromoethane
Yu, Ze,Jiang, Jialiang,Chen, Hongtai,Tang, Xiangyang
, p. 2544 - 2552 (2021)
Aliphatic bromide was used as a halogenation reagent in the presence of DMSO, resulting in 2,2-diarylvinyl bromides from the corresponding 1,1-diarylethylenes. This protocol not only provides a convenient and straightforward strategy for the rapid construction of various 2,2-diarylvinyl bromides without bromine and extra oxidants, but also can improve the atom economy of Kornblum oxidative reaction.
